The growth of online gaming is closely linked to the rise of massive multiplayer online games (MMOs). These games invite thousands of players to share the same virtual environment, each contributing to a dynamic world that evolves based on collective actions. Titles like World of Warcraft, Final Fantasy XIV, and EVE Online have demonstrated how storytelling, socialization, and competition can blend into a single immersive experience. Casual gaming has also exploded in popularity, largely driven by mobile platforms. Games like Candy Crush, Among Us, and Clash Royale attract millions of users daily with their accessibility and engaging mechanics. Mobile online games have lowered the barriers to entry, making gaming a part of everyday life for a wider demographic than ever before. This accessibility extends to cross-platform gaming, allowing users on PCs, consoles, and smartphones to play together seamlessly, breaking down the walls that once divided gamers by device.
Another critical element of online gaming’s evolution is the integration of social features. Voice chat, live streaming, and in-game messaging create vibrant communities and enhance player interaction. Streaming platforms such as Twitch and YouTube Gaming have transformed players into content creators and influencers, turning gameplay into a spectator sport. The social dimension of online games encourages collaboration, competition, and the sharing of moments, making the experience more immersive and personal.
Esports, a professional branch of online gaming, has gained tremendous traction worldwide. What started as small tournaments among enthusiasts has blossomed into a multi-billion-dollar industry with international competitions, celebrity players, and massive audiences. Games like League of Legends, Dota 2, and Counter-Strike: Global Offensive have professional leagues, sponsorships, and fan bases rivaling traditional sports. Esports exemplifies how online gaming is not just about entertainment but also about skill, strategy, and career opportunities.

Many popular games adopt a free-to-play model, relying on in-game purchases, season passes, and cosmetic upgrades to generate revenue. This model democratizes access, allowing anyone to join while giving players the option to customize their experience. While controversial at times, these revenue systems have enabled developers to support ongoing content updates and server maintenance, keeping games fresh and engaging over time.
The ongoing development of technology continues to push the boundaries of what online gaming can offer. Cloud gaming services are emerging, allowing high-end games to be streamed on less powerful devices without sacrificing quality. Virtual reality (VR) and augmented reality (AR) are beginning to add new layers of immersion, enabling players to step inside the game worlds in unprecedented ways. Artificial intelligence and machine learning are also being harnessed to create smarter opponents, personalized gameplay experiences, and dynamic narratives that adapt to individual player choices.
